Inspiration 1952

60 years ago this month the well dressed (and well heeled) woman might have been wearing this yellow Otterburn tweed suit with matching stole lined in velvet to keep out the chill. I certainly would, especially on a day like today with freezing fog and the pavements like skating rinks. By Michael at LaChasse, Around Town & Shopping Opportunities December 1952.

If you find anything made of Otterburn tweed it is great quality and will keep you toasty on any chill and dank morning. The mill closed in 1976 I think. I have a couple of pieces and they are so warm (and bright!).
